Post Office Passport Seva Kendra inaugurated in Adilabad

Adilabad, March 02: The Telangana Forest Minister
Jogu Ramanna on Thursday inaugurated the Post Office Passport Seva Kendra in Adilabad town.

The facility will help reduce the time in obtaining a passport considerably, the Minister said.

Hyderabad Regional Passport Officer Vishnuvardhan Reddy said about 30 applications for passports would be processed every day at the Seva Kendra. A speeded-up police verification process would have the government delivering the passports within one week of application, he added.

Adilabad Superintendent of Police Vishnu S. Warrier, Adilabad MP G. Nagesh, Collector D. Divya and Chief Post Master Chandra Shekhar also attended.
